Kaowimari No.2 Population - Dibrugarh, Assam

Kaowimari No.2 is a medium size village located in Moran Circle of Dibrugarh district, Assam with total 46 families residing. The Kaowimari No.2 village has population of 206 of which 102 are males while 104 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Kaowimari No.2 village population of children with age 0-6 is 24 which makes up 11.65 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kaowimari No.2 village is 1020 which is higher than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Kaowimari No.2 as per census is 412, lower than Assam average of 962.

Kaowimari No.2 village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Kaowimari No.2 village was 64.84 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Kaowimari No.2 Male literacy stands at 71.76 % while female literacy rate was 58.76 %.

Caste Factor

There is no population of Schedule Caste (SC) and Schedule Tribe(ST) in Kaowimari No.2 village of Dibrugarh district.

Work Profile

In Kaowimari No.2 village out of total population, 50 were engaged in work activities. 74.00 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 26.00 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 50 workers engaged in Main Work, 0 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ourer.
